Overview
The Economic Development Specialist supports Stanly County’s business attraction, retention, and expansion efforts by serving as the primary point of contact for existing businesses, assisting with recruitment efforts, and providing research, marketing, and RFI support.
Responsibilities- Serve as the primary point of contact for existing businesses and for RFI support.
- Assist in business attraction, retention, and expansion initiatives.
- Conduct a minimum of five industry site visits per month.
- Participate in local, regional, and state committees as appropriate.
- Develop and maintain materials for business recruitment and marketing packets.
- Provide site location assistance to prospective businesses and meet with prospective business representatives.
- Screen and handle economic development inquiries via telephone and in person.
- Provide assistance to the Economic Development Director and coordinate program-specific activities and projects.
- Conduct research on county statistics and demographics for internal and external use.
- Schedule, set up, attend meetings, take minutes, and coordinate catering as needed.
- Coordinate and implement economic development projects, including RFI preparation.
- Create flyers, marketing materials, and maintain/up‑date the department website.
- Compose, edit, and coordinate the preparation of reports or other printed materials and maintain databases to monitor information.
- Manage deadlines, workflow, and coordinate activities efficiently.
- Bachelor’s degree in economics, planning, communications, marketing, or a related field and at least two (2) years of relevant experience; or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
- Possession of a valid North Carolina driver’s license.
- Considerable knowledge of business development and attraction principles, retention strategies, project coordination, marketing practices, and modern office procedures.
- Strong research skills and ability to compile clear, concise written reports, studies, and memoranda.
- Excellent oral and written communication skills, with the ability to communicate effectively with employees, local and state agencies, and the general public.
- Ability to independently make routine administrative decisions in accordance with laws, regulations, and county policies and procedures.
- Strong organizational skills and ability to prioritize and manage multiple tasks.
- Fluency in establishing and maintaining effective working relationships with industry representatives, public officials, supervisors, employees, and the general public.
- Competency in county rules, regulations, policies, and procedures.
Willingness to travel occasionally for work and flexibility to work outside of normal business hours, including early mornings, evenings, or occasional weekends, as needed.
